University of Spa & Cosmetology Arts Acceptance Rate
University of Spa & Cosmetology Arts runs an open-access admission policy. With a 100% acceptance rate, the focus is on getting qualified students in, not filtering them out.

University of Spa & Cosmetology Arts Application Deadlines & Admission Dates 2026
University of Spa & Cosmetology Arts follows a Rolling Admissions policy, meaning applications are reviewed as they arrive and there is no single fixed deadline.
Key Admission Dates
University of Spa & Cosmetology Arts reviews applications continuously throughout the year. Seats and scholarships are awarded on a first-come, first-served basis, so applying early gives you a significant advantage for both admission and financial aid.

Is a University of Spa & Cosmetology Arts Degree Worth It?
Whether University of Spa & Cosmetology Arts is worth it depends less on its reputation and more on your program choice, financial aid package, and career goals. Here's the data to weigh it against.
The average household income among admitted students is $54,700, with a graduate unemployment rate of 3.25%.
43% of students receive a Pell Grant and 46.8% take federal loans at University of Spa & Cosmetology Arts. File your FAFSA early and list University of Spa & Cosmetology Arts as a choice to be considered for both.
How much does a University of Spa & Cosmetology Arts Graduate earn?
Median earnings 10 years after enrollment (roughly 4–6 years post-graduation) are $27,084. That's somewhat below the U.S. median graduate income of $40,595.
